首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ql的乘法函数的使用方法

MySQL 中的乘法函数主要是 POW()POWER(),这两个函数都可以用来计算一个数的幂,但在 MySQL 中,通常推荐使用 POWER() 函数。不过,如果你想要实现两个数的乘法,可以直接使用乘法运算符 *

基础概念

  • 乘法运算符 *:用于计算两个数的乘积。
  • POWER() 函数:用于计算一个数的指定次幂。语法为 POWER(base, exponent),其中 base 是底数,exponent 是指数。

相关优势

  • 乘法运算符 * 简单直观,易于理解和使用。
  • POWER() 函数提供了更强大的数学运算能力,可以处理指数运算。

类型与应用场景

  • 乘法运算符 *:适用于任何需要进行乘法运算的场景,如计算总价、面积等。
  • POWER() 函数:适用于需要进行指数运算的场景,如计算复利、幂函数等。

示例代码

使用乘法运算符 * 进行乘法运算

代码语言:txt
复制
SELECT 3 * 4 AS result;

结果:

代码语言:txt
复制
+--------+
| result |
+--------+
|      12|
+--------+

使用 POWER() 函数进行指数运算

代码语言:txt
复制
SELECT POWER(2, 3) AS result;

结果:

代码语言:txt
复制
+--------+
| result |
+--------+
|      8 |
+--------+

遇到的问题及解决方法

问题:为什么使用 POWER() 函数计算的结果与预期不符?

  • 原因:可能是由于浮点数精度问题导致的。在进行指数运算时,如果底数或指数是浮点数,可能会产生精度损失。
  • 解决方法:尽量使用整数进行指数运算,或者使用 ROUND() 函数对结果进行四舍五入以减少精度损失。

示例:

代码语言:txt
复制
SELECT ROUND(POWER(2.5, 2), 2) AS result;

结果:

代码语言:txt
复制
+--------+
| result |
+--------+
|   6.25 |
+--------+

以上就是关于 MySQL 乘法函数的使用方法及相关信息的完整解答。如果你还有其他问题或需要进一步的帮助,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

sqrt mysql_MySQLSQRT函数使用方法「建议收藏」

推荐:MySQLSUM函数使用教程这篇文章主要介绍了MySQLSUM函数使用教程,是MySQL入门学习中基础知识,需要朋友可以参考下 MySQLSUM函数是用来找出记录中各种字段总和。...现在,假设根据上面的表想来计算所有的dialy_typing_pages总数 这篇文章主要介绍了详解MySQLSQRT函数使用方法,是MySQL入门学习中基础知识,需要朋友可以参考下 MySQL...SQRT函数是用来计算出任何数量平方根。...可以使用SELECT语句找出方检定根任意数如下: ? 所看到浮点值,因为内部MySQL将处理浮点数据类型平方根。 可以使用SQRT函数,计算出记录平方根。...分享:101个MySQL调试和优化技巧副标题#e# MySQL是一个功能强大开源数据库。随着越来越多数据库驱动应用程序,人们一直在推动MySQL发展到它极限。

65220
  • MySQL分组查询与聚合函数使用方法(三)

    上节课我们介绍了MySQL数据写入与where条件查询基本方法,具体可回顾MySQL数据插入INSERT INTO与条件查询WHERE基本用法(二)。...本节课我们介绍MySQL分组查询与聚合函数使用方法。 1 GROUP BY分组查询 在 MySQL 中,GROUP BY 关键字可以根据一个或多个字段对查询结果进行分组。...2 聚合函数 聚合函数(aggregation function)表示在分组基础进行数据统计,得到每组统计结果一种操作。例如,前面提到对每个性别的生存概率统计也使用到聚合函数。...在MySQL中,常用聚合函数包括以下几种。...3 总结 以上就是GROUP BY分组查询与聚合函数基本用法,在日常很多查询任务中两者通常结合使用,大家可以多加练习使用。下节课我们准备给大家介绍MySQL子查询基本用法,敬请期待!

    4.1K20

    getchar()函数使用方法

    getchar()函数使用方法 getchar()函数功能是一个一个地读取你所输入字符。...其实,你按了回车之后,这四个字符会被存储到键盘缓冲区,这个时候你使用getchar()函数,他会从键盘缓冲区里一个一个去读取字符。...还有一个问题需要注意 getchar()函数返回值,它返回值其实是你所输入字符ASCII值 比如,你输入是‘A’在调试过程中,我们可以看到,他值是65,65就是getchar()返回值...常见一个问题 getchar()!=EOF和getchar()!...=’\n’这两者有何区别 EOF代表是在操作系统中表示资料源无更多资料可读取 ‘\n’代表是回车键 我们在输入时候往往会按回车代表我输入结束了,程序你开始就执行吧。

    1.2K30

    了解phpstripos函数使用方法

    一、什么是phpstripos函数 1、phpstripos函数是php编程语言中一个函数。该函数用于在一个字符串中查找另一个字符串第一次出现位置(不区分大小写)。...2、该函数区别于php中strpos函数,因为它不区分字母大小写。...三、phpstripos函数使用方法 1、使用phpstripos函数可以实现查找字符串中指定字符是否存在,如下:     $string = "Hello World!"...2、未确定haystack类型:在使用phpstripos函数时,需要确定haystack参数类型是否为字符串,否则会引发错误。...五、phpstripos函数注意事项 1、phpstripos函数大小写敏感,因此必须要小写或大写。 2、phpstripos函数在有些服务器上可能性能较低,因此建议使用strpos函数

    53940

    Python Lambda函数几种使用方法

    函数就是Python中Lambda函数,下面就来为大家解析lambda函数基本使用方法。 为什么要使用Python Lambda函数?...相对于我们定义可重复使用函数来说,这个函数更加简单便捷。 如何在Python中编写Lambda函数?...匿名函数加速Python运行 在比较所需代码量之前,让我们首先记下正常函数语法,并将其与前面描述lambda函数进行比较。...Python Lambda函数几种使用方法 示例一:定义一个普通python函数并嵌入Lambda,函数接收传入一个参数x。然后将此参数添加到lambda函数提供某个未知参数y中求和。...示例三:Lambda函数+map函数 Python中map()函数是一个将给定列表值依次在所定义函数关系中迭代并返回一个新列表。

    2.7K30

    Java script中函数使用方法

    前言 什么是函数,就是把一段相对独立具有特定功能代码块封装起来,形成一个独立实体,就是函数,起个名字(函数名),在开发中可以反复调用,函数作用就是封装一段代码,可以重复使用。 1....一个函数一般都特定用来干 一件 事情 1.2 调用 调用函数语法: 函数名(); 特点: 函数体只有在调用时候才会执行,调用需要()进行调用。...带参数函数调用 函数名(实参1, 实参2, 实参3); *形参和实参 * 形式参数:在声明一个函数时候,为了函数功能更加灵活,有些值是固定不了,对于这些固定不了值。...// 函数执行时候会把x,y复制一份给函数内部a和b, // 函数内部值是复制新值,无法修改外部x,y JS 函数在调用时,允许传多个实参,就是实参个数可以比形参个数多; 1.3 函数返回值...作业: 求1-n之间所有数和 求n-m之间所有数和 求2个数中最大值 1.4 函数相关其它事情 1.4.1 匿名函数与自调用函数 匿名函数:没有名字函数 匿名函数如何使用: 将匿名函数赋值给一个变量

    1K00

    Excelsum相关函数使用方法

    sum相关函数 测试数据 编号 成绩 1 55 2 87 3 86 4 87 5 60 6 79 7 89 8 69 9 61 10 79 sum 返回某一单元格区域中所有数字之和。 ...Sum_range 是需要求和实际单元格。  说明  只有在区域中相应单元格符合条件情况下,SUM_range 中单元格才求和。  如果忽略了 SUM_range,则对区域中单元格求和。 ...WPS表格 还提供了其他一些函数,它们可根据条件来分析数据。例如,如果要计算单元格区域内某个文本字符串或数字出现次数,则可使用 COUNTIF 函数。  ...如果要让公式根据某一条件返回两个数值中某一值(例如,根据指定销售额返回销售红利),则可使用 IF 函数。  sumifs 用于计算其满足多个条件全部参数总量。...说明 ■数组参数必须具有相同维数,否则,函数 SUMPRODUCT 将返回错误值 #VALUE!。  ■函数 SUMPRODUCT 将非数值型数组元素作为 0 处理。

    9810

    详解Python中算术乘法、数组乘法与矩阵乘法

    (1)算术乘法,整数、实数、复数、高精度实数之间乘法。 ? (2)列表、元组、字符串这几种类型对象与整数之间乘法,表示对列表、元组或字符串进行重复,返回新列表、元组、字符串。 ?...(5)numpy数组与array-like对象点积,通过numpy数组dot()方法或numpydot()函数实现。...数组与标量相乘,等价于乘法运算符或numpy.multiply()函数: ? 如果两个数组是长度相同一维数组,计算结果为两个向量内积: ?...如果两个数组是形状分别为(m,k)和(k,n)二维数组,表示两个矩阵相乘,结果为(m,n)二维数组,此时一般使用等价矩阵乘法运算符@或者numpy函数matmul(): ?...7)连乘,计算所有数值相乘结果,可以使用标准库函数math.prod(),Python 3.8之后支持。 ? 扩展库函数numpy.prod()提供了更强大功能。 ?

    9.2K30

    MySQL常用函数

    MySQL常用函数 关于时间和字符串类型函数差不多已经介绍完了,今天补充一些常用函数。...1.条件判断函数if和ifnull if函数用法是:if(expr,value1,value2),首先判断表达式值,然后根据表达式值返回value1和value2当中某一个。...这个转换是个相互过程,包含两个函数,一个是inet_aton(expr),另外一个是inet_ntoa(expr)函数,这两个函数使用方法如下: root@localhost:3306 [(...convert和cast cast使用方法是cast(x as type); convert使用方法是convert(x type); 可以转换类型有binary,char...类似show processlist,select version(),select user(),select database()等等,没有写,这些想必也都知道,关于mysql内置函数这部分大概就这几天四篇文章吧

    1.1K10
    领券